Matir Moyna is a great art film by Famous film maker Tarek Masud.


Actually the film is about pre liberation war situation of Bangladesh. It covers description of important political and historical events of Bangladesh (so called East Pakistan) from 1966 to 1971.

It creates a silent revolution against some illogical muslim nyth.

The main character Anu is 10 years old boy. whose father forced him to go madrasa. but the environment of madrasa was not favour in him. Anu has a little sister. She also became victim of her father's dectatorship.....

director includes some exclusive real documents here in the film like original news paper of 1970, radio voice of 1970s' election declaration of Bangladesh, real film poster and wall writing of the period of 1966.....

Tareque / Catherine Masud knows Marketing very well. I know him since his first attempt Adam Surat.

Well, Matir Moyna is a good try, got loads of publicity; but [with due respect] its not a GOOD film. There was not any sign of character build up; that Anu's father role was not established properly.
